Roadwork Closes Portion of Chesapeake Road for 30 days

Repairs could affect route for Fort Bragg commuters.

Beginning Monday, Aug. 1, a portion of Chesapeake Road will be closed for road maintenance for at least 30 days. The roadwork will include, but is not limited to, culvert replacement.

The portion that will be closed is near Anson Pond, closest to the McArthur Road entrance between Anson Drive and Hidden Valley Drive.

Anyone using Anson Drive, Carteret Place, and Shoreline Drive can enter on McArthur Road.

Anyone using Hidden Valley Drive, Waterbury Drive, and Farmview Drive can enter on Stacy Weaver Drive.

“We advise motorists to use caution in the Chesapeake Road area during this road closure and ask that they utilize the proper entrances to minimize traffic issues,” said Rusty Thompson, City Traffic Engineer. “We appreciate our citizens’ patience as crews work on Chesapeake Road.”
